Dear patient, Yes, it is possible to get Dysport in Adelaide. Dysport is a neurotoxin commonly used in medical aesthetics to reduce the appearance of wrinkles and fine lines. It works by temporarily paralyzing the muscles that cause these lines, resulting in a smoother and more youthful appearance. If you are interested in getting Dysport, I recommend that you consult with a qualified and experienced plastic surgeon. A plastic surgeon can assess your individual needs and determine if Dysport is the right treatment option for you. They will also be able to provide you with detailed information about the procedure, including potential risks and side effects. During the consultation, the plastic surgeon will evaluate your skin condition, facial anatomy, and your goals for the treatment. They will discuss the areas where Dysport can be injected and the expected results. It is important to have a realistic expectation of the outcome and to understand that the effects of Dysport are temporary and may require repeat treatments to maintain the desired results.
